Cinnamon: Oil distilled from the leaves contains mainly Eugenol (@75%). Leaf oil is in great use commercially in foods, mouth preparations, soaps and toiletries. Warm and spicy aroma; it's a rich, yellow oil which lacks the depth and body of cinnamon bark oil. Used as an insecticide, emmenagogue, antispasmodic, antibacterial, aphrodisiac and antifungal particularly against Candida and Aspergillis. Eases colds and breathing difficulties. As an inhalation, it is excellent for exhaustion, feelings of depression and weakness. It is a very effective antiseptic, digestive and anti-rheumatic and is regarded as one of the strongest antiseptic oils. Not recommended for skin care. Very powerful, should be used with extreme care.
Distillation Method: steam distilled Country of Origin: Ceylon Botanical Name: Cinnamomum zeylanicum Part: Leaf __________________________________________________________

Clary Sage Essential Oil - Clary Sage is well known for its balancing properties. Used in PMS blends, it is reputed to help with menopause and menstrual cramps. Our Clary Sage is sourced in America and smells richer and more smooth than the Russian or Chinese sourced Clary Sage. Flashpoint is 172 F.
Distillation Method: Steam Distillation Country of Origin: USA Botanical Name: Salvia Sclarea Part: Leaves ________________________________________________________

Clove bud oil has a sweet, rich, warm, spicy and penetrating aroma with a fruity top note and a woody base note. Highly irritant to the skin and must be diluted. Clove bud oil is safer to use than clove leaf due to its lower eugenol content. It should never be used directly on the skin or in large concentrations. Clove bud oil lifts depression and is recommended as an inhalation when feeling weak and lethargic. It's excellent as an antiseptic because of the high proportion of eugenol. It helps stimulate digestion, restores appetite and relieves flatulence. The dental value of cloves is well know, the oil has been traditionally used to relieve toothaches. Blends well with basil, cinnamon, citronella, orange and peppermint. Very powerful, should be used with extreme care.
__________________________________________________________
Distillation Method: steam distilled
Country of Origin: Madagascar
Botanical Name: Eugenia caryophyllata
Part: bud
